@AMXBummerz4 жыл бұрын
I have the mk3.5 ST3 deisel absolutely love it but being ford theyve spent the money the performance feel and the seats, interior build quality not so much, there are the odd creeks and rattles, the common rattle is the drivers door drives you mad if you dont have music on, other thing is the 19'' wheels that I have mean there is no such thing as a comfortable drive
